Side Effects ships Houdini 9.5
updated 04:05 pm EDT, Tue July 29, 2008
Houdini 9.5 ships
Having completed its beta program, Side Effects has released the full 9.5 version of Houdini, its professional 3D animation suite. This is the first version of the software for the Mac, but changes from past versions include improved documentation, with phrase and Boolean searches as well as division into beginner, intermediate and advanced instructions.
Other features include Illustrator import, FBX, QuickTime and Torque Engine export, and miscellaneous interface enhancements. New effect options include wave, river and fracture tools, and more than a dozen new types of surface nodes. The software requires Mac OS X Leopard, and an Intel Mac with 1GB of RAM. A Houdini Escape subscription costs $1,995 per month, while a Master one is $7,995; a personal version of the app costs $100 though, or nothing with watermarking and limited resolution.
